Using original imported chips, this combined chip not only has the advantages of good optical uniformity, extremely insensitive to the influence of the laser polarization state and incident angle, but also has a fairly high resistance to laser damage. Under normal circumstances, users do not need to consider the problem of laser beam damage to the detector.


Features:


It has the characteristics of stable work, accurate measurement, small size and convenient use.


The small detector structure of the instrument solves the problem that the detector of the general laser power meter is too large to be easily inserted into the optical path for testing in the optical laboratory.

Basic principle Based on the calorimetric principle.


The light absorbing target surface receives the laser radiation and converts it into heat energy, and the heat capacity is transferred to the heat sink to generate a temperature difference in the heat flow channel. The temperature difference is measured by the thermopile sensing element to realize the measurement of the laser power. The instrument performs subsequent processing on the signal and displays it. The electronic instrument amplifies and adjusts the voltage signal output by the detector, and displays it through the meter to indicate the measured power value.
